Anybody here have a 1990-ish Ford Ranger 4x4? Looking at picking one up soon but i dunno how good they are.
If you've driven one Ranger, you've driven them all. They don't change much at all through the years. If you can get one with a 4.0, you'll have a decent bit more power than the lil 2.9 the older ones had though. And if it's going to be a DD, the newer ones with torsion bar suspension have a more comfortable ride than the older ones with twin I-beam. I drive my 96 4.0 back and forth to school(400 miles) a few times a year no problem though.
